Title

Two limit transitions involving multivariable BC type Askey-Wilson polynomials

Abstract

In the first part (without proofs) an orthogonality measure with partly discrete and partly continuous support will be introduced for the five parameter family of multivariable BC type Askey-Wilson polynomials. In the second part, the limit transitions from BC type Askey-Wilson polynomials to BC type big and little q-Jacobi polynomials will be described in detail.
